If you’re viewing this page on a Windows PC, you’re already relying on several system processes to get here. At the top is the Windows system kernel (ntoskrnl.exe), which allows software to communicate with your PC hardware. Lower-level applications like Chrome (chrome.exe) use the kernel to display pages like this one.

Unfortunately, not every application and system service is reliable. Bugs, security holes, and high CPU usage are common and depend on regular Windows updates to fix them. Ironically, Windows Update itself can cause high CPU and RAM usage via related services like waasmedic. Here’s what you need to know.

The wassmedic service (also known as Windows Update Medic Service and Wassmedicagent.exe) is a background system service that handles part of the Windows Update process. Waasmedic is responsible for protecting Windows Update from being disabled or mishandled (for example by rogue malware infections).
